Bürkliplatz Flea Market temporarily relocated Due to the complete renovation of the Stadthaus grounds, the Bürkliplatz flea market will be relocated 2025 to the surrounding streets and Münsterhof. However, Münsterhof will not be open on some dates. For more details, consult the flea market website. |
In a picturesque location by Lake Zurich, this flea market – which was founded over 50 years ago – is the largest and most popular of its kind.
With over 230 seasonal pitches, the flea market on Bürkliplatz attracts art enthusiasts and collectors who love browsing through an extensive range of antiques, vintage items, and second-hand treasures. From retro clothing to unique works of art, here you can find objects that tell stories and are oozing with character.
From May to October, the market not only offers the opportunity to make amazing finds, but also to become part of a lively community. For those interested in running a market stall, there is a weekly draw, which gives everyone the chance to offer their treasures to the general public. This ensures that there is always a changing selection of items on offer.
